python爬虫入门第8天_python抓取图片站的图片地址

from selenium import webdriver

#启动浏览器
cb = webdriver.Chrome()                #cb就是浏览器
cb.get('http://angelimg.spbeen.com/')  #get就是访问这个地址
html = cb.page_source                  #提取网页,当前网页的代码
print(html)

#现在有了网页代码,下一步就提取图片地址
from lxml import etree
htmlobj = etree.HTML(html)             #把网页做一个解析,变成html对象,有对象就能提取内容
                                       #将html字符串解析成html对象
img_links = htmlobj.xpath('.//img/@src')                        #xpath 提取内容

#xpath里的内容
#打开浏览器按F12,打开调试工具
#在“element”里面按CTRL+f
#//代表全局,在里面寻找img标签,然后取img的src,src是img的属性,所以要加@

for link in img_links:
    print(link)
print('提取到了{}个图片链接'.format(len(img_links)))在这里插入代码片

img是图片标签。该标签下有多个属性。
属性1:src 属性
src 用于指定图片的路径(或图片的地址),其中 src 是英文 source(源头,资源) 的缩写。
属性2:alt 属性
指定无法显示图像时的提示文字。
属性3:title 属性
当鼠标经过图片上时,会显示 title 属性中的文字。
属性4:width、height 属性
width 用于指定图片的宽度,height 用于指定图片的高度。

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

题海无涯10

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值